To build on this progress and to help put more money in the pockets of Canadians, the Government has proposed to raise the Basic Personal Amount (BPA), which is the amount of money Canadians can earn before they have to pay federal income tax. If your investment losses exceed your capital gains for the year, you can use the excess to reduce your other taxable income, up to a $3,000 maximum. While a tax deduction reduces your taxable income, a tax credit reduces the amount of tax you owe the IRS. Taxpayers who qualify to make deductible traditional IRA contributions, which are subject to limitations based on income and active participation in an employer retirement plan, can deduct up to $6,000 for themselves and $6,000 for a spouse (with a $1,000 catch-up for those 50 and older) as an above-the-line deduction. This technique, called "bunching," can increase their deductible charitable contributions for a single year, causing them to outspend the standard deduction and make itemizing in that year the right tax move. Self-employed filers may deduct a portion of their self-employment tax, contributions to certain self-employed retirement plans and health insurance premiums, among other deductions. Known as a dependent care FSA, parents can set aside as much as $5,000 if filing a joint tax return ($2,500 for single filers) that can be spent on qualifying dependent care expenses. In practice, few taxpayers need to worry about the limit -- this means that someone with AGI of $100,000 could deduct as much as $60,000 in charitable donations. To claim a work-related deduction: 1. you must have spent the money yourself and weren't reimbursed 2. it must directly relate to earning your income 3. you must have a record to prove it.If the expense was for both work and private purposes, you can only claim a deduction for the work-related portion. Eligible educators can deduct up to $250 ($500 if married filing jointly and both spouses are educators) of unreimbursed expenses related to your job, including books, supplies and computer equipment.
